In UT, where do people go for their divorce documents?
If you are in the county in which the divorce happened, you can go to your local County Court office and apply for the UT divorce decrees. If you live in a different state a written request can be sent.
The original divorce certificates is given to you at the time of the divorce, and typically a copy of the certification of divorce is kept with the divorce lawyer.
